    5 year nursing course in Phillipines?

    Thought this was an interesting article: The Manila Times Internet Edition | OPINION >Five-year nursing and other courses, boon or bane?


    Beginning February 15, the Commission on Higher Education (CHED) will start consultations with colleges and universities on its decision to raise nursing from a four-year to a five-year course. By the beginning of the new school year in June, CHED said it would start to implement the plan.
